Chapter 1 Dissect the inner meaning of the book Will I Ever
Be Good Enough
"Will I Ever Be Good Enough? Healing the Daughters of
Narcissistic Mothers" is a self-help book written by Dr. Karyl
McBride. Published in 2008, the book explores the effects of
having a narcissistic mother and offers guidance on how to heal
from the emotional trauma associated with this experience. The
author draws upon her own professional expertise as a licensed
marriage and family therapist, as well as personal experiences,
to provide insight and support for individuals who have faced the
challenges of having a narcissistic parent. The book delves into
the impact of narcissistic mothers on their daughters'
self-esteem, relationships, and overall mental well-being, and
offers strategies for individuals to reclaim their lives.

Chapter 3 Synopsis of the book Will I Ever Be Good
Enough
"Will I Ever Be Good Enough? Healing the Daughters of
Narcissistic Mothers" is a self-help book written by Karyl
McBride. The book explores the complex and often dysfunctional
dynamic between daughters and their narcissistic mothers,
offering guidance and strategies for healing and reclaiming one's
self-esteem.
The main focus of the book is on daughters who have grown up with
narcissistic mothers, who prioritize their own needs and
constantly seek attention and validation. These mothers often
undermine their daughters' self-worth and manipulate them
emotionally, leaving lasting scars on their sense of identity and
self-belief.
McBride draws from her own experience as a therapist specializing
in narcissistic abuse recovery and shares stories and case
studies of women who have faced similar challenges. She outlines
the various patterns of narcissistic behavior and the
psychological effects they can have on daughters, such as
feelings of never being "good enough" and struggling with
perfectionism and self-doubt.
Throughout the book, McBride provides practical advice and tools
for healing and developing self-compassion. She discusses the
importance of setting boundaries, letting go of self-blame, and
finding support from others who have gone through similar
experiences. McBride also emphasizes the significance of
reconnecting with one's authentic self and rebuilding
self-esteem.
Ultimately, "Will I Ever Be Good Enough?" aims to empower
daughters of narcissistic mothers to break free from the cycle of
abuse, heal their emotional wounds, and create a fulfilling and
authentic life. It offers hope and validation for those
struggling with the impact of narcissistic parenting, providing a
roadmap for personal growth and self-acceptance.
